Despite being well (and we mean well) over a decade ago, The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im is still a popular game. So much so that it has been re-released several times, even becoming a meme in the process.

That said, considering the game came out in 2011, it's pretty rough in some areas. And that's where mods come in. Not only that, but given its endurance, modders have also added to the game, helping to make the experience last even longer than the estimated 207-hour completion time.

As such, according to Nexus Mods, an all-encompassing website dedicated to game mods, the original version of Skyrim has topped over two billion mod downloads.

Screenshot 2025-01-03 at 12.51.59

It has only been surpassed by Skyrim Special Edition, which has managed to top a whopping 6.2 billion mod downloads. Additionally, four of the top five by downloads are Bethesda-published games: Skyrim Special Edition, Original Skyrim, Fallout 4, and Fallout New Vegas. In other words, a lot of mods are downloaded to improve these games.

If we take to the original Skyrim page, the mods that are most popular of downloads are things that help make the game feel “modern”. For example, the most popular mod by downloads is the “SkyUI” mod, with over 25 million downloads.

That mod makes the user interface more user-friendly, complete with the ability to use text-to-search, categorize favorites, and improved inventory management, among other additions.

Elsewhere, the “HD 2K Texture” modpack is a high-resolution addition to the base Skyrim game, while the “Flora Overhaul” does exactly what the name suggests, beefing up the game's vegetation.

In total, there are over 65,000 mods spanning over 3,200 pages of content for the original Skyrim. This week alone, 16 new mods were added to the game. Of these 16, two of them were added at the time of writing. While it remains to be seen whether it will pass the Skyrim Special Edition, one thing is for sure: don't doubt Skyrim's enduring popularity.
